- the present invention relates to a selective herbicidal composition for controlling grasses and weeds in crops of cultivated plants, especially in crops of maize and cereals, which composition comprises a herbicide and a safener (antidote) and protects the cultivated plants, but not the weeds, from the phytotoxic action of the herbicide, and to the use of said composition for controlling weeds in crops of cultivated plants.
- the cultivated plants may also suffer severe damage owing to factors that include the concentration of the herbicide and the mode of application, the cultivated plant itself, the nature of the soil, and the climatic conditions such as exposure to light, temperature and rainfall.
- EP-A-0 094 349 discloses quinoline derivatives that protect cultivated plants from the phytotoxic action of herbicides of specific substance classes including chloroacetanilides, phenoxypropioniate herbicides, ureas, triazines, carbamates or diphenyl ethers.
- EP-A-0558 448 discloses l,5-diphenylpyrazole-3-carboxylic acid derivatives for protecting cultivated plants from the phytotoxic action of sulfonyl ureas.
- the safeners selected from the two compound classes of the quinoline derivatives and 1 -pheny lazole-3-carboxylic acid derivatives are suitable for protecting cultivated plants from the phytotoxic action of 3-hydroxy-4-aryl-5- oxopyrazoline derivatives.

- the compounds of formula I are disclosed in WO 92/16510 and EP-A-0508 126 as insecticides, acaricides and herbicides.
- the invention also relates to a method of selectively controlling weeds in crops of cultivated plants, which comprises treating said cultivated plants, the seeds or seedlings or the crop area thereof, concurrently or separately, with a herbicidally effective amount of the herbicide of formula I and, to antagomse the herbicide, an antidotally effective amount of the safener of formula Ha, ub or ⁇ b ⁇
- Suitable cultivated plants which can be protected by the safener of formula Ha, ub and ⁇ b j against the harmful action of the aforementioned herbicides are preferably maize and cereals.
- the weeds to be controlled can be monocot as well as dicot weeds.
- Crop areas will be understood as meaning the areas already under cultivation with the cultivated plants or seeds thereof, as well as the areas intended for cropping with said cultivated plants.
- a safener of formula Ila, Ub and Hbj can be used for pretreating seeds of the crop plants (dressing of seeds of seedlings) or it can be incorporated in the soil before or after sowing. It can, however, also be applied by itself alone or together with the herbicide postemergence. Treatment of the plant or the seeds with the safener can therefore in principle be carried out irrespective of the time of application of the herbicide. Treatment can, however, also be carried out by simultaneous application of the phytotoxic chemical and safener (e.g. as tank mixture).
- the concentration of safener with respect to the herbicide will depend substantially on the mode of application. Where a field treatment is carried out either by using a tank mixture with a combination of safener and herbicide or by separate application of safener and herbicide, the ratio of safener to herbicide will usually be from 100:1 to 1:10, preferably from 20:1 to 1:1.
- the concentration of herbicide is usually in the range from 0.001 to 2 kg/ha, but will preferably be from 0.005 to 1 kg/ha.
- compositions of this invention are suitable for all methods of application commonly used in agriculture, including preemergence application, postemergence application and seed dressing.
- safener/kg of seeds For seed dressing, 0.001 to 10 g of safener/kg of seeds, preferably 0.05 to 2 g of safener/kg of seeds, is usually applied. If the safener is used in liquid form shortly before sowing to effect soaking, then it is preferred to use safener solutions that contain the active ingredient in a concentration of 1 to 10000 ppm, preferably of 100 to 1000 ppm.
- the safeners of formula Ila, ub or ub ⁇ are processed together with the herbicides tof formula I together with the assistants conventionally employed in formulation technology to emulsif ⁇ able concentrates, coatable pastes, directly sprayable or dilutable solutions, dilute emulsions, wettable powders, soluble powders, dusts, granulates or microcapsules.
- the formulations are prepared in known manner, conveniently by homogeneously mixing or grinding, or mixing and grinding, the active ingredients with liquid or solid formulation assistants, typically solvents or solid carriers. Surface-active compounds (surfactants) may additionally be used for preparing the formulations.
- Suitable solvents may typically be: aromatic hydrocarbons, preferably the fractions containing 8 to 12 carbon atoms such as xylene mixtures or substituted naphthalenes; phthalates such as dibutyl or dioctyl phthalate; aliphatic hydrocarbons such as cyclohexane or paraffins; alcohols and glycols and their ethers and esters such as ethanol, diethylene glycol, 2-methoxyethanol or 2-ethoxyethanol; ketones such as cyclohexanone; strongly polar solvents such as N-methyl-2-pyrrolidone, dimethyl sulfoxide or dimethyl formamide; as well as vegetable oils or epoxidised vegetable oils such as epoxidised coconut oil or soybean oil; or water.
- aromatic hydrocarbons preferably the fractions containing 8 to 12 carbon atoms such as xylene mixtures or substituted naphthalenes
- phthalates such as dibutyl or dioctyl phthalate
- the solid carriers typically used for dusts and dispersible powders are usually natural mineral fillers such as calcite, talcum, kaolin, montmorillonite or attapulgite.
- natural mineral fillers such as calcite, talcum, kaolin, montmorillonite or attapulgite.
- highly dispersed silicic acid or highly dispersed absorbent polymers such as calcite, talcum, kaolin, montmorillonite or attapulgite.
- Suitable granulated adsorptive carriers are porous types, including pumice, broken brick, sepiolite or bentonite; and suitable nonsorbent carriers are materials such as calcite or sand.
- innumerable pregranulated materials of inorganic or organic origin may be used, especially dolomite or pulverised plant residues.
- suitable surface-active compounds are nonionic, canonic and/or anionic surfactants having good emulsifying, dispersing and wetting properties.
- surfactants will also be understood as comprising mixtures of surfactants.
- Suitable anionic surfactants may be water-soluble soaps as well as water-soluble synthetic surface-active compounds.
- Suitable soaps are the alkali metal salts, alkaline earth metal salts, ammonium salts or substituted ammonium salts of higher fatty acids ( 0 -C 22 , e.g. the sodium or potassium salts of oleic or stearic acid, or of natural fatty acid mixtures which can be obtained, inter alia from coconut oil or tallow oil. Further suitable soaps are also the fatty acid methyl taurin salts.
- so-called synthetic surfactants are used, especially fatty sulfonates, fatty sulfates, sulfonated benzimidazole derivatives or alkylarylsulfonates.
- the fatty alcohol sulfonates or sulfates are usually in the form of alkali metal salts, alkaline earth metal salts, ammonium salts or substituted ammonium salts, and they contain a Cg-C ⁇ alkyl radical which also includes the alkyl moiety of acyl radicals, e.g. the sodium or calcium salt of ligninsulf onic acid, of dodecylsulf ate, or of a mixture of fatty alcohol sulfates obtained from natural fatty acids.
- These compounds also comprise the salts of sulfated and sulfonated fatty alcohol/ethylene oxide adducts.
- the sulfonated benz ⁇ imidazole derivatives preferably contain two sulfonic acid groups and one fatty acid radical containing 8 to 22 carbon atoms.
- alkylarylsulfonates are the sodium, calcium or triethanolamine salts of dodecylbenzenesulfonic acid, dibutylnaph- thalenesulfonic acid, or of a condensate of naphthalenesulfonic acid and formaldehyde.
- Corresponding phosphates typically salts of the phosphoric acid ester of an adduct of p-nonylphenol with 4 to 14 mol of ethylene oxide, or phospholipids, are also suitable.
- Nonionic surfactants are preferably polyglycol ether derivatives of aliphatic or cycloaliphatic alcohols or of saturated or unsaturated fatty acids and alkylphenols, said derivatives containing 3 to 30 glycol ether groups and 8 to 20 carbon atoms in the (aliphatic) hydrocarbon moiety and 6 to 18 carbon atoms in the alkyl moiety of the alkylphenols.
- nonionic surfactants are the water-soluble polyadducts of polyethylene oxide with polypropylene glycol, ethylenediaminopolypropylene glycol and alkylpolypropylene glycol containing 1 to 10 carbon atoms in the alkyl chain, which polyadducts contain 20 to 250 ethylene glycol ether groups and 10 to 100 propylene glycol ether groups. These compounds usually contain 1 to 5 ethylene glycol units per propylene glycol unit
- nonionic surfactants are nonylphenol polyethoxylates, polyethoxylated castor oil, polyadducts of polypropylene and polyethylene oxide, tributylphenol polyethoxylate, polyethylene glycol and octylphenol polyethoxylate.
- Fatty acid esters of polyoxyethylene sorbitan are also suitable nonionic surfactants, typically polyoxyethylene sorbitan trioleate.
- Cationic surfactants are preferably quaternary ammonium salts carrying, as N-substituent, at least one Cg-C 2 _ a U c yl radical and, as further substituents, unsubstituted or halogenated lower alkyl, benzyl or hydroxy-lower alkyl radicals.
- the salts are preferably in the form of halides, methyl sulfates or ethyl sulfates, for example stearyl trimethylammonium chloride or benzyl bis(2-chloroethyl)ethylammonium bromide.
- the agrochemical compositions will usually contain from 0.1 to 99 % by weight, preferably from 0.1 to 95 % by weight, of safener or mixture of safener and herbicide, from 1 to 99.9 % by weight, preferably from 5 to 99.8 % by weight, of a solid or liquid formulation assistant, and from 0 to 25 % by weight, preferably from 0.1 to 25 % by weight, of a surfactant
- compositions may also contain further ingredients such as stabilisers, antifoams, viscosity regulators, binders, tackifiers, as well as fertilisers or other chemical agents.
- Seed dressing a) Dressing the seeds with a wettable powder formulation of the compound of formula Ha, Ub or Ilb j by shaking in a vessel until the safener is uniformly distributed on the surface of the seeds (dry treatment), using up to c. 1 to 500 g of compound of formula Ua, Ub or Ubi (4 g to 2 g of wettable powder) per 100 kg of seeds.
- Seed dressing or treatment of the germinated seedlings are naturally the preferred methods of application, as the safener treatment is fully concentrated on the target crop.
- 1 to 1000 g, preferably 5 to 250 g, of safener is used per 100 kg of seeds.
- other chemical agents or micronutrients plus or minus deviations from the indicated limiting concentrations are possible (repeat dressing).
- a liquid formulation of a mixture of safener and herbicide (reciprocal ratio from 10:1 to 1 : 100) is used, the concentration of herbicide being from 0.005 to 5.0 kg/ha. This tank mixture is applied before or after sowing.
- the safener formulated as emulsifiable concentrate, wettable powder or granulate is applied to the open furrow in which the seeds have been sown. After covering the furrow, the herbicide is applied pre-emergence in conventional manner.
- a solution of the compound of formula Ua, Ub or Ubj is applied to mineral granulate substrates or polymerised granulates (urea/formaldehyde) and allowed to dry.
- a coating may additionally be applied (coated granulates) which permits controlled release of the safener over a specific period of time.
